Top 5 Tower Defense Games Performance in the Middle East Q4 2023
The top 5 tower defense games in the Middle East saw varied performance in Q4 2023, with notable tr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
The fourth quarter of 2023 witnessed intriguing trends in the performance of the top 5 tower defense games on a unified platform in the Middle East. Here's a closer look at each game's performance,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Rush Royale: Tower Defense TD showed a dynamic revenue pattern, peaking at around $71K in the final week of December. Weekly downloads also experienced a steady rise, reaching 5.6K by the end of the quarter. Active users maintained a consistent presence, peaking at approximately 77.6K in late October.
Kingdom Guard:Tower Defense TD exhibited a steady revenue increase, topping at $42.6K in mid-October. The game saw its highest downloads in the same period, with 8.8K weekly downloads. Active users peaked at around 21.4K at the end of October, showing a robust engagement.
Watcher of Realms experienced a significant growth in revenue, reaching approximately $11.9K by the end of November. Weekly downloads saw an initial surge, peaking at 3.5K in late October. Active users followed a similar trend, peaking at around 4.4K in mid-December.
Plants vs. Zombies™ 2 maintained a consistent revenue stream, peaking at roughly $4.2K in late December. The game had a notable spike in downloads in early October, reaching 12.4K. Active users peaked at around 47K in the same period, indicating strong player retention.
Finally, Bloons TD 6 displayed a steady revenue increase, peaking at approximately $3.3K in the final week of December. The game saw a significant rise in downloads towards the end of the quarter, reaching nearly 1K. Active users also increased, peaking at around 2.2K in late December.
